‘Crow Nation’ Evaluate: A Beautiful, Sleazy Revival of ’90s Survival Horror

Regardless that fashionable horror video games have gotten frighteningly thrilling, there’s nonetheless room for that particular old-school survival horror really feel. With a mix of muddy graphics, cryptic puzzles, sluggish pacing and clunky controls, PlayStation-era video games resembling resident Evil And silent Hill have been capable of create a particular kind of rigidity and terror. Crow Nation that is what would occur if video games like this by no means went out of style. It seems and seems like a traditional, however with simply the correct amount of contemporary parts. That is the right instance of traditional horror.

Crow Nation belongs to the indie studio SFB Video games, led by brothers Tom and Adam Vian, which has managed to create fairly an eclectic library of releases to date. There was playful Change launch title Snapperslips, point-and-click homicide thriller Tangle Towerand now a darkish survival horror sport. Crow Nation does not simply trigger 90s – the motion additionally takes place throughout this era. The sport takes place in an deserted amusement park in Atlanta in 1990, as a lady named Mara goes in quest of the elusive proprietor of the park, who has mysteriously disappeared. After all, this place is teeming with monsters and secrets and techniques.

The very first thing you may discover is how related it’s to a 32-bit sport. The eye to element is impeccable, from blocky characters to fuzzy textures and crunchy, distorted sounds. Even the menu matches the period. This extends to how the sport is performed and the way it’s structured. Initially, Mara solely has entry to a small a part of the park, however steadily you’ll uncover extra by amassing unusual objects, keys of a sure colour, and fixing very unusual puzzles. The park itself is each scary and comical, similar to within the authentic resident Evil the mansion intersected with 5 Nights at Freddy’s.

You progress like, properly, tank: The motion is sluggish, you must cease to shoot zombie-like enemies, and the aiming is intentionally irritating to extend the strain. Likewise, you may need to cope with restricted assets and comparatively meager ammo and medication to maintain going. All this fills the hazard of even small conferences. You doing No I need to waste bullets. It helps that the monster designs are genuinely unsettling, with fast-running infants, spindly-legged monsters, and shifting blobs with faces.

What’s most outstanding about Crow NationNevertheless, that is the way it builds on the old-fashioned sensibilities with some very good high quality of life modifications. Maybe the most important factor: the digicam is definitely 3D, so you possibly can transfer it round to get a greater have a look at your environment. However there’s additionally a extra fashionable management choice for higher capturing, a restricted trace system in case you miss a kind of little clues, a really helpful map, and secure rooms that truly make you are feeling secure so you possibly can catch your breath and plan the next step. . There’s even a mode that removes enemies completely for those who simply need to discover the realm.

What’s spectacular is that these updates do not relieve the traditional rigidity. They merely eradicate some (however not all) of the frustration inherent ’90s-era survival horror that created maybe probably the most accessible instance of the style whereas sustaining the look, really feel, and persona. Crow Nation does all this whereas telling an ideal thriller that ramps up dramatically over the course of its roughly 5 hours of playtime. It does not fairly surpass its inspirations, however it would remind you why you appreciated them a lot.

Crow Nation obtainable now on PS5, Steam and Xbox Sequence X/S.
